The Rise of Project Management Platforms

Traditional project management methods in the infrastructure industry often struggle with real-time data access, communication breakdowns, and resource allocation challenges. This leads to delays, cost overruns, and ultimately, project failure. Project management platforms like Project Excavator are designed to address these issues, offering a centralized hub for managing all aspects of a project.

Key Features Driving Adoption

Project Excavator's appeal stems from a combination of features that streamline operations and improve efficiency. These include:

  • Real-time data visualization: Provides an up-to-the-minute view of project progress, resource allocation, and potential bottlenecks.
  • Enhanced communication tools: Facilitates seamless communication between project teams, stakeholders, and contractors, significantly reducing miscommunication.
  • Automated workflows: Streamlines repetitive tasks, ensuring accuracy and reducing manual errors.
  • Resource allocation optimization: Allows for efficient allocation of manpower, equipment, and materials, minimizing delays and maximizing productivity.
  • Comprehensive reporting and analytics: Provides detailed insights into project performance, enabling proactive decision-making and cost control.
